What is Mass Employment Credit FEC
The Massachusetts Full Employment Credit Schedule FEC is a government tax form used by qualified employers to claim the Full Employment Credit for eligible employment months.

Purpose and Benefits of the Massachusetts Full Employment Credit Schedule FEC
The Massachusetts Full Employment Credit provides specific financial advantages to qualified employers by subsidizing their hiring costs. The credit is calculated at $100 for each month of eligible employment per employee, potentially reaching up to a maximum of $1,200 per participant. These calculations encourage businesses to sustain their workforce and expand hiring activities.
To qualify for this credit, employers must meet several criteria, including the recruitment of eligible candidates. Understanding the associated limitations and eligibility requirements can empower businesses to make informed hiring decisions while optimizing their financial outcomes through this credit.

Who is eligible to use the Massachusetts Full Employment Credit Schedule FEC?
Qualified employers in Massachusetts who have hired eligible employees during specific months can use this form to claim the Full Employment Credit.
What is the deadline for submitting the Schedule FEC?
Deadlines can vary; typically, you should submit the Schedule FEC with your Massachusetts tax return when it is due to ensure credit eligibility.
How can I submit the Massachusetts Schedule FEC?
You can submit the completed Schedule FEC form electronically through tax filing software or by including it in your mailed tax return package.
What supporting documents are required with the FEC form?
While the Schedule FEC itself may not require additional documents, you should have records of employee eligibility and employment duration ready for verification.
What are common mistakes to avoid when filling out the Schedule FEC?
Common mistakes include incorrect Federal ID numbers, miscalculating eligible months, and failing to check the correct business type.
How long does it take to process the Massachusetts Full Employment Credit?
Processing times may vary, but you can typically expect to hear back regarding your credits within several weeks after submission.
What should I do if I have unused credits from previous years?
For unused credits, refer to the instructions on the Schedule FEC regarding carryover options to claim them in future tax years.
